15 lines
421 B
JavaScript
15 lines
421 B
JavaScript
|
export default async function b64toBlob(b,type){
|
||
|
// https://ionic.io/blog/converting-a-base64-string-to-a-blob-in-javascript
|
||
|
// https://github.com/jeremyBanks/b64-to-blob/blob/master/b64toBlob.js
|
||
|
|
||
|
// size limit?
|
||
|
|
||
|
//console.log({b,type})
|
||
|
const u = `data:${type};base64,${b}`
|
||
|
//console.log({u})
|
||
|
const f = await fetch(u) // this always works?
|
||
|
const blob = await f.blob()
|
||
|
//console.log({blob})
|
||
|
return blob
|
||
|
}//func
|